About the Role Were looking for an experienced Product Support Associate to help build the best customer experience team in Canada! As part of our Product Support team, you will focus on delivering exceptional customer service, product education, and software troubleshooting when our customers need it most. Please note: Float Product Support operates from 5am-5pm (PT) MF and 6am-2pm on weekends. Following a MF 6am-2pm onboarding period, this role will follow a fixed schedule of five consecutive 8hour shifts within operating hours. This isnt any ordinary support role. Here's what youll be responsible for: Product Support & Service Delivery - Provide Exceptional Support: Deliver awardwinning product support, product education, and bespoke solutions for our customers that are exceptional, courteous, and onbrand. We are not a bank. Our interactions are human, empathetic, and memorable. - Technical Troubleshooting: Diagnose and resolve technical issues involving Floats software, integrations to other systems, user provisioning and authentication and web and mobile platforms. - Compliance & Security: Ensure KYB/KYC and other compliance and verification processes are followed, maintaining security and integrity of the platform. - Undocumented Issues: Perform technical investigations into unexpected behaviours, providing timely, accurate, and empathetic resolutions. Subject Matter Expertise - Internal Resource: Become a subjectmatter expert businesswide, providing guidance, insights, and solutions. Be a responder in internal question channels (Slack) and uphold high standards for information quality and accuracy. - Collaborative Knowledge Sharing: Share and mutuallyreinforce accuracy, precision and relevance of technical product knowledge among colleagues. Provide peer feedback when standards are not met. Knowledge Management & Documentation - Issue Tracking & Reporting: Classify and track customer issues and resolutions using tools like Zendesk, HubSpot, Linear, and Metabase. - Content Production and Upkeep: Participate in a regular process to produce, audit, maintain, and update knowledge base articles, FAQs, and process documentation to ensure accuracy and relevance. - Optimize With and For AI: Use AI tools to build, organize and refine knowledge content, while optimizing it for ingestion by AI support tools and AI Agents. Functional Optimization & Collaboration - Process Execution: Follow established support processes, including defect escalations and approvalgated actions, ensuring adherence to quality standards. - CustomerCentric Insights: Proactively identify and propose changes to the product, processes or service delivery which would reduce support case volume and remove points of friction for customers. - Special Projects & Initiatives: Occasionally represent Product Support in special projects and reactive crossdepartmental engagements, ensuring alignment on customer needs and support priorities.
